66AK2G02: Questions about 66AK2G02 parallel interface + 1024K FFT

Part Number: 66AK2G02
Other Parts Discussed in Thread: FFTLIB, , TMS320C6748, 66AK2G12

We are trying to use this chip for a new DSP project. We need to read data at over 100 Mbytes per second from FPGA (ADC samples).

Bus width should be 16 or 32 bits.

I was wondering if there is any parallel interface which can read at that data rate in this microprocessor?

In this project, we need to do 1 Meg FFT (1024K).

Can we use hte routines in FFTLIB for this CPU?

On the FFTLIB page it says that it works with 66AK2E02 (With "E" not with "G") : http://www.ti.com/tool/FFTLIB

Is it because this library was posted in 2014 before the 66AK2G02 was released?

If it does not wirk with the G02, I would like to know which FFT library works with that CPU?

What is the time required to do 1024K FFT on that processor?

    Thanks for your feedback here. I regret that you have not had a good experience with K2G support. The underlying set of experts supporting both K2G and c6748 products is the same, so I assure you , you will be in good hands.
    We did have a little hiccup in support during holidays, but now we are striving to have customer issues addressed as soon as we can.
    K2G is relatively new compared to c6748, so some times support queries may inherently take longer.
    Both device choices are great , c6748 definitely has much more unique power-performance-cost sweet spot.
    However if you are looking for a Cortex A class ARM, c66x DSP and higher performance (c6748 will tap out at 456 MHz) - both K2Gx and AM570x family may still be relevant for you.

    There are 2 sets of references for power management solutions for K2G, and I hope you have seen both. The processor has a good amount of integration so it does have more power railes.

    Please look at the following post
    e2e.ti.com/.../654782

    This talks about the existing power supply design that supports the 600 MHz K2G and below has pointers for 1GHz K2G version.

    Existing 66AK2Gx evaluation module will be updated with TPS65911A + 66AK2G12 in near future. It’s just a BOM change.
    http://www.ti.com/tool/evmk2g

    Another power solution option for K2G is discrete power solution used on the 66AK2Gx ICE.
    http://www.ti.com/tool/k2gice
